Understanding the Square Wave vs Sine Wave Inverter Choice in Faridabad
The core difference between these two technologies lies in the waveform of the electricity they produce. A square wave inverter is an earlier-generation technology that delivers power in abrupt, blocky blocks, which is highly inefficient for modern appliances. In contrast, a sine wave inverter mimics the smooth, continuous grid power supplied by DHBVN, ensuring stable operation. Performance Side-by-Side
When comparing performance under Faridabad's demanding Composite climate conditions, the differences become stark:
- Power Quality: Sine wave inverters deliver smooth electricity, preventing the humming noise and overheating common with square wave alternatives.
- Switchover Speed: Traditional square wave systems have slow transition times, causing computers and smart TVs to reboot during a DHBVN outage.
- Surge Handling: Sine wave systems handle high-startup loads of modern refrigerator compressors much better than legacy square wave setups.

Fit for Faridabad Use Cases
For a sophisticated Tier-1 city like Faridabad, use cases dictate the technology. If you only need to run basic resistive loads like incandescent bulbs or simple fans, a square wave system might suffice. However, for homes with routers, laptops, LED TVs, and modern kitchen appliances, a sine wave output is non-negotiable to prevent operational glitches.
